Winter is the coldest season of the year, occurring between autumn and spring. It typically lasts from December to March in the Northern Hemisphere. Winter is characterized by shorter days, colder temperatures, and, in many regions, snow and ice. People often engage in activities like skiing, ice skating, and celebrating holidays such as Christmas and New Year’s.
